As of April 24, 2026, 11:04 UTC, shares of paint and coatings manufacturer Sherwin-Williams closed the most recent trading session at $337.66, drawing renewed investor attention after a 7.64% one-month gain that followed a muted 90-day trading period. Return metrics reveal a clear deceleration in momentum: the stock posted a 1.86% 1-year total shareholder return (TSR), a sharp pullback from its 49.02% 3-year TSR, as broader construction sector softness weighed on near-term performance. Expert Insights

The conflicting valuation signals for SHW present a nuanced risk-reward framework for investors, separating near-term trading risks from long-term fundamental value. First, the 13% undervaluation implied by consensus forecasting models is underpinned by a largely underpriced market share opportunity: as peers pull back on customer support, marketing, and product innovation to preserve margins during the current industry downturn, SHW’s targeted investments are driving sticky loyalty among professional contractors, who represent roughly 70% of the firm’s annual revenue. This share gain trajectory is expected to support 3-5% annual revenue growth above the 2% long-term industry average through 2030, a dynamic that has not been fully priced into current trading levels. The elevated trailing P/E ratio, often cited as a bearish signal, is partially inflated by temporary input cost pressures and one-off supply chain expenses recorded in the prior 12 months. Forward P/E based on 2027 consensus earnings estimates falls to 23.4x, below the firm’s estimated fair P/E ratio of 25x, indicating that the relative valuation premium is far smaller than trailing metrics suggest. That said, the narrow gap between SHW’s current P/E and peer group averages does mean that any earnings miss in the upcoming Q2 2026 earnings report could trigger 5-8% near-term downside, as investors re-rate multiples lower. For long-term investors with a 3+ year holding horizon, the risk-reward remains skewed to the upside, with a base case total return of 17% including dividends over the next 12 months.
